WebAxial Skeleton. Your axial skeleton is made up of the 80 bones within the central core of your body. This includes bones in your skull (cranial and facial bones), ears, neck, back (vertebrae, sacrum and tailbone) and ribcage (sternum and ribs). The first 2, C1 and C2, are highly specialized and are given unique names: atlas and axis, respectively. C3-C7 are more classic vertebrae, having a body, pedicles, laminae, spinous processes, and facet joints.
